Job Description
As a Light Weight Technician, you will play a crucial role in our fabrication processes. This is not your typical warehouse job; you'll be working with advanced equipment and materials, ensuring products meet the highest standards of quality and safety.
Key Responsibilities
Physical Tasks:
Stand for extended periods (up to 12 hours).
Perform frequent bending, stooping, twisting, kneeling, reaching, pushing, and pulling.
Use various personal protective equipment (PPE) such as hard hats, steel-toed boots, safety glasses, and more.
Occasionally wear respiratory protection equipment.
Climb steps and/or ladders frequently while carrying tools and materials.
Operate light-duty service trucks and forklifts once a permanent employee.
Work in hot and cold environments.
Maintain good balance and manual dexterity for handling knives and heavy equipment.
Manual Dexterity:
Exhibit good eye/hand coordination and grasping ability.
Work with moving equipment and heavy-duty machinery with numerous pinch points.
Pay close attention to detail.
Mental Dexterity:
Demonstrate strong communication skills.
Comprehend and follow verbal and written instructions with minimal supervision.
Maintain accurate paperwork and general mathematics skills.
Read and measure tape accurately.
Exhibit excellent problem-solving skills and adapt to unexpected situations.
Requirements:
Ability to perform all physical tasks listed above. Strong eye/hand coordination and attention to detail. Excellent communication skills. Basic mathematical skills (addition, subtraction, multiplication). Experience with operating light-duty trucks and forklifts is a plus. Ability to work in a physically demanding environment.
